Red Wings’ Ken Holland analyzing trade market as team heads to Tampa Bay | Freep
“I’ve talked to lots of teams over the last week and 10 days, and I’m doubling back with a number of them,” Holland said. “We’d like to get assets, open up spots for a kid or two for next season.”
This is what I want to read.
Ken Holland is kicking those tires and then circling the car and kicking them again. Getting as many assets as possible is incredibly helpful when rebuilding. It gives the Red Wings more chances to hit on one of their draft picks.

Atlantic Division at the trade deadline: Four buyers, four sellers | ESPN
All the usual suspects are mentioned for the Wings in their trade deadline game plan and the focus is Mike Green.
If the Wings can’t pull at least what the Blues got for Kevin Shattenkirk last season, it’ll be a whiff.
I agree with this, but the biggest thing for me is getting that 1st round pick. If Holland can add that to the Detroit’s own 1st and their two early 2nd rounders, that should give the team four picks in the top 40 (give or take). That’s huge.
